Germany vs Curaçao Preview: World Cup Group Stage Match
Match Context
Germany face Curaçao at NRG Stadium in Houston on 14 June 2026 in World Cup Group Stage - 1. Both sides enter with 0 points and a goal difference of 0 in Group E, each listed as “Advancing to the Round of 32” in the current standings snapshot.
